Health Minister Mark Holland (Ajax, Ont.) and New Brunswick Minister of Health John Dornan announced a bilateral agreement investing over $32 million to improve access to selected new drugs for rare diseases, and to support enhanced access to existing drugs, early diagnosis, and screening. Parliamentary Secretary to the Minister for Women and Gender Equality and Youth Lisa Hepfner (Hamilton Mountain, Ont.) announced over $4.3 million to St. Joseph’s Healthcare Hamilton in Hamilton, Ont., to build a peer-led program to enhance care for people who use drugs during and after hospitalization. Parliamentary Secretary to the Minister of Health Yasir Naqvi (Ottawa Centre, Ont.)  announced more than $ 1.3 million to Operation Come Home in Ottawa. This project will support youth aged 16-25 who are street-involved or experiencing homelessness, and who are at-risk of harms from substance use. The full release is available online. Health Minister Mark Holland (Ajax, Ont.) announced that more than three million Canadians have been approved for coverage through the Canadian Dental Care Plan (CDCP).
